First-Prize Take 5 Ticket Sold At ShopRite In Northern Westchester One lucky shopper at a supermarket in Northern Westchester took home a first-prize-winning lottery ticket worth over $18,000, officials announced.  The top-prize-winning Take 5 ticket, worth $18,188.50, was bought in Bedford Hills for the midday drawing on Sunday, March 17, New York Lottery officials said. The ticket was bought at the ShopRite supermarket at 747 Bedford Rd. (Route 117), officials added.  The name of the lucky winner was not released.

Winning Lottery Ticket Worth Nearly $30K Sold At Westchester Gas Station: Here's Where Someone out there is nearly $30,000 richer after buying a winning lottery ticket at a Westchester gas station, officials announced. The top-prize-winning Take 5 ticket, worth $29,796.50, was sold at a Yonkers gas station for the drawing on Sunday, Feb. 11, New York Lottery officials announced. The ticket was revealed to have been bought at a Sunoco gas station at 931 McLean Ave., officials added. $1,000,000 Powerball Ticket In $748.3M Drawing Sold In Westchester New York is one of three states in which a second-place ticket worth $1 million for the Powerball drawing on Saturday, Sept. 23 was purchased. It was sold in Westchester County at Chestnut Mart on 69 Theodore Fremd Ave. in Rye. The two other $1M tickets were sold in California and Florida. There was no first-prize winner in the $748,300,000 drawing. The jackpot for the new drawing on Monday, Sept. 25 is now at $785,000,000.

Top-Prize Winning Take-5 Ticket Sold At Buchanan Gas Station One lucky winner has found themselves thousands richer after buying a winning top-prize lottery ticket at a Northern Westchester gas station.  The winning Take 5 ticket, worth $8,799, was sold for the Thursday, Sept. 7 evening drawing in Buchanan, New York Lottery announced.  The ticket was bought at M&V Petroleum (a Shell gas station) located at 3190 Albany Post Rd., lottery officials said. Lottery officials added that the winner has up to a year to claim their prize.

Cha-Ching! $3,000,000 Mega Millions Prize Claimed By NY Trust A lucky New Yorker has millions of reasons to be smiling after hitting it big on a lottery ticket. In Saratoga County, a Ballston Spa-based trust claimed a $3,000,000 Mega Millions Megaplier prize from the Jan. 10 drawing, New York Lottery announced. The lucky player matched the first five of the winning numbers, which were 7-13-14-15-18 and Mega Ball 9. The Megaplier can multiply non-jackpot prizes up to five times. New York Woman Wins $5 Million Scratch-Off Prize A woman from New York City won a $5 million lottery prize. Patricia Kontrafouris, of Brooklyn, claimed a top prize from the X Series: 100X scratch-off game, New York Lottery announced on Friday, Jan. 6. The lottery said Kontrafouris received her prize as a single, lump-sum payment of $3,061,000 after required withholdings. The winning ticket was purchased at KKISB, which is located at 100-06 4th Ave. in Brooklyn, NY Lottery said.

Northern Westchester Man Wins $5 Million Lottery Prize A man from Northern Westchester has claimed a $5 million lottery prize. Richard Bossi, of North Salem, won the top prize from New York Lottery's Mega Multiplier scratch-off game, NY Lottery announced on Friday, Jan. 6. The winning ticket was purchased in Putnam County at the Route 22 Convenience Store, located at 876 Route 22 in Brewster, the lottery said. NY Lottery said Bossi received his prize as a single, lump-sum payment of $3,255,000 after required withholdings.

New York Man Wins $1M Mega Millions Prize A man from New York City won a $1 million lottery prize. Omar Williams, of Brooklyn, claimed the prize after matching the first five numbers in the Mega Millions drawing on Tuesday, Sept. 20, New York Lottery reported on Wednesday, Nov. 30. Williams received his prize as a single, lump-sum payment of $612,240 after required withholdings, NY Lottery said.  The lottery said the winning numbers from the drawing were 09 21 28 30 52 Mega Ball 10. The ticket was purchased at Ansha, which is located at 6842 4th Ave. in Brooklyn, NY Lottery said.

New York Man Wins $1M Scratch-Off Prize A Long Island man won a $1 million New York Lottery prize. Julian De Jesus Paz Lorenzana, of Hempstead, claimed his prize from the lottery's Lucky 13 scratch-off game, NY Lottery announced on Wednesday, Nov. 30. He received his prize as a single, lump-sum payment of $496,440 after required withholdings, the lottery reported. NY Lottery said the winning ticket was purchased at Double Diamond Food Mart, which is located at 196 Henry St. in Hempstead.
